Kokhav Ya’akov

Kokhav Ya'akov is a religious Israeli settlement organized as a community settlement in the . Located near the Palestinian town of , it is administered by .

Aerodrome
Photo: Ehudg, Public domain.
Jerusalem International Airport was a regional airport located in the city of . When it was opened in 1925, it was the first airport in the British Mandate for Palestine. is situated 3 km southwest of Kokhav Ya’akov.

Archaeological site
Tell en-Nasbeh, likely the biblical city of Mizpah, is a 3.2 hectare tell located on a low plateau 12 kilometers northwest of in the . is situated 3 km west of Kokhav Ya’akov.
